libceph: primary_temp decode bits



Add a common helper to decode both primary_temp (full map, map<pg_t,
u32>) and new_primary_temp (inc map, same) and switch to it.

static int __decode_primary_temp(void **p, void *end, struct ceph_osdmap *map,
				 bool incremental)
{
	u32 n;

	ceph_decode_32_safe(p, end, n, e_inval);
	while (n--) {
		struct ceph_pg pgid;
		u32 osd;
		int ret;

		ret = ceph_decode_pgid(p, end, &pgid);
		if (ret)
			return ret;

		ceph_decode_32_safe(p, end, osd, e_inval);

		ret = __remove_pg_mapping(&map->primary_temp, pgid);
		BUG_ON(!incremental && ret != -ENOENT);

		if (!incremental || osd != (u32)-1) {
			struct ceph_pg_mapping *pg;

			pg = kzalloc(sizeof(*pg), GFP_NOFS);
			if (!pg)
				return -ENOMEM;

			pg->pgid = pgid;
			pg->primary_temp.osd = osd;

			ret = __insert_pg_mapping(pg, &map->primary_temp);
			if (ret) {
				kfree(pg);
				return ret;
			}
		}
	}

	return 0;

e_inval:
	return -EINVAL;
}

static int decode_primary_temp(void **p, void *end, struct ceph_osdmap *map)
{
	return __decode_primary_temp(p, end, map, false);
}

static int decode_new_primary_temp(void **p, void *end,
				   struct ceph_osdmap *map)
{
	return __decode_primary_temp(p, end, map, true);
}
